The ingredients needed to make Gujarati dal:
  1. Prepare 1 1/2 cup toor dal
  2. Make ready 1 tomato chopped
  3. Get 2 spoons jaggery
  4. Prepare 1 lemon juice
  5. Take 2 cloves
  6. Make ready 1 star anise
  7. Take 2 dry red chillies
  8. Take 1 tsp Mustard seeds
  9. Make ready 3-4 curry leaves
  10. Prepare 1 tsp Turmeric powder
  11. Make ready 1 inch ginger grated
  12. Take 2 chilli halved
  13. Make ready Pinch Asafoetida
  14. Take 1 tsp Shahi jeera
  15. Take as per taste Kashmiri Red chilli powder
  16. Take as per taste Salt
  17. Make ready as required Chopped coriander
  18. Make ready as required Oil

Gujarati Dal, also popular as "Khatti Meethi Daal" is a healthy dish prepared from tuvar dal (toor dal/arhar dal/pigeon pea lentils) and many Indian spices.

Instructions to make Gujarati dal:
  1. Wash toor dal well and then add in cooker. Then add water and steam it until it become soft.
  2. Then after steamed using hand blender crush it to a fine paste add ½ cup water and mix.
  3. Take utensil for tadka and add oil to it. Then add clove,red chilli dried, star anise and then add mustard seeds, Shahi jeera, asafoetida, curry leaves.
  4. Then cook for a while and again add crushed dal. Then mix and add salt, turmeric, Kashmiri red chilli powder, ginger, chilli and mix it.
  5. Then add jaggery, 1 lemon juice, mix it.
  6. Cook it for some time then add coriander. Now serve khatti mithi Gujarati dal with rice, papad.
